Real estate developers are in a unique position to leverage the design of landscaping and outdoor spaces to not only enhance the lives of residents, but create purpose-built spaces, encourage sustainable living, and create a more positive environmental footprint. This not only attracts more residents, but also enhances the overall aesthetic of a property, creating a more welcoming and pleasant living environment for all.


Firstly, incorporating different plants and planters that represent different seasons can create a dynamic and visually appealing landscape. For example, planting tulips and daffodils in the spring, hydrangeas and sunflowers in the summer, and mums and pumpkins in the fall can create a beautiful and seasonal display. Additionally, designing outdoor spaces with different seasons in mind can create an immersive experience for residents, allowing them to enjoy the beauty of nature throughout the year.


Secondly, incorporating outdoor spaces that can be enjoyed all year round can make a significant difference in the quality of life of residents. For example, incorporating features such as pergolas or outdoor heating systems can make outdoor spaces more comfortable and inviting throughout the year.


Furthermore, leveraging the design of landscaping can also create more functional and practical outdoor spaces for modern families. For example, creating outdoor play areas or sports courts can cater to the needs of families with children. Additionally, incorporating edible gardens or greenhouses can provide residents with fresh produce and promote sustainable living.


Incorporating outdoor spaces that are designed with different seasons in mind can also contribute to the health and well-being of residents. Exposure to nature and natural elements such as sunlight, fresh air, and greenery has been shown to have numerous health benefits, including reduced stress, improved mood, and increased physical activity levels.


Leveraging the design of landscaping can also contribute to the environmental sustainability of a property. By incorporating native plants and creating natural habitats for wildlife, developers can promote biodiversity and reduce the impact of development on the surrounding ecosystem. Additionally, incorporating features such as rain gardens or bioswales can promote water conservation and reduce the risk of flooding.


Everyone has a part to play within a community, and by carefully considering the amenities you provide, a developer can drastically change the impact their project has on the entire neighbourhood, and even the environment at large.
